What is Hyaluronidase?
Hyaluronidase Pinewood Laboratories is a sterile injectable preparation containing the enzyme hyaluronidase. It is supplied in a concentration suitable for intramuscular and subcutaneous administration and is marketed in the European Union as a prescription‑only product. The enzyme acts on hyaluronic acid in the extracellular matrix, temporarily increasing tissue permeability. This formulation is used by healthcare professionals to facilitate the dispersion and absorption of co‑administered injectable agents.
What is Hyaluronidase used for?
Hyaluronidase Pinewood Laboratories is employed in clinical practice to improve the performance of injectable therapies and to manage specific fluid‑related situations. Its enzymatic activity helps clinicians achieve more predictable drug distribution and address certain complications associated with subcutaneous injections. - Enhances absorption of co‑administered subcutaneous or intramuscular drugs, such as local anesthetics or antibiotics. - Facilitates subcutaneous fluid uptake in hypodermoclysis for hydration or medication delivery. - Assists in the dispersion of contrast agents during ophthalmic or radiologic procedures. - Supports treatment of extravasation injuries caused by vesicant chemotherapy agents. - Aids in the breakdown of hyaluronic acid accumulations to improve tissue infiltration during certain dermatologic interventions.
What are the side effects of Hyaluronidase?
Adverse reactions to hyaluronidase are generally localized and transient, but systemic or severe events can occur in rare cases.
Common: - Mild erythema, swelling, or warmth at the injection site. - Transient pain or tenderness during or shortly after administration. - Localized itching or mild urticaria.
Serious: - Allergic anaphylaxis presenting with respiratory distress, hypotension, or urticaria. - Severe tissue necrosis or ulceration at the injection site. - Systemic hypersensitivity reactions such as serum sickness–like symptoms.
What precautions apply to Hyaluronidase?
When using Hyaluronidase Pinewood Laboratories, clinicians should evaluate patient history and procedural factors to minimize risks and ensure appropriate use. - Confirm absence of known hypersensitivity to hyaluronidase or related enzymes before injection. - Use the lowest effective dose and limit the injection volume to reduce local tissue irritation. - Avoid administration in areas with compromised blood flow or active infection. - Monitor patients for immediate signs of allergic reaction, especially during the first exposure. - Exercise caution in pregnant or lactating individuals, as safety data are limited. - Do not inject intravascularly; ensure proper subcutaneous or intramuscular placement. - Store the product according to manufacturer guidelines to maintain enzymatic activity.
What does Hyaluronidase interact with?
Hyaluronidase can modify the distribution of concurrently administered agents, which may affect efficacy or safety of other medications.
Avoid: - Avoid simultaneous injection of vesicant chemotherapy agents without prior hyaluronidase administration to prevent enhanced tissue injury. - Do not combine with other enzymes that degrade extracellular matrix components, as additive effects on tissue permeability may occur.
Use with caution: - Use cautiously with drugs that have narrow therapeutic windows, such as insulin or anticoagulants, because altered absorption could change plasma levels. - Monitor patients receiving local anesthetics when hyaluronidase is added, as faster systemic uptake may increase toxicity risk. - Exercise caution when co‑administering contrast media for imaging, ensuring appropriate dosing to prevent excessive diffusion. - Consider potential interaction with biologic agents that rely on controlled subcutaneous absorption.
